    Re: Acer eMachines d725 with win7 ultimate not booting up

    1) Go to System Restore: Go to the Control Panel and then enter into System and Security -> System, Here you have to click on System Protection then System Restore. Go to the Start and then Search, click the System Restore program.

    2) For Command Prompt: type in Start -> Search cmd, then right-click on cmd.exe -> Run as administrator. Rstrui.exe type and confirm with Enter System Restore wizard opens, click Next Checking Show other restore points. Select the restore point to the desired date by highlighting it and click Next. Verify that this is indeed the appropriate restore point. Read the instructions, especially if the password has been changed recently and close all programs, then click Finish. Validate warning message with Yes. The system prepares, session is closed, restoring boots, wait. The system restarts and after opening the session a success message appears.
